Output 6a1624cd278e1acb29ff9441ef2fce5d17d9caafc6fde406dc3d61a2811f1ef3:1

value
51102964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 278c173481750d5622e59089de83d3e49c185b59 OP_EQUAL
address
35J86hCApqNif6tywCUFHP13XLkcSgzDqN
transaction
6a1624cd278e1acb29ff9441ef2fce5d17d9caafc6fde406dc3d61a2811f1ef3
spent
true